About this role
Fortinet secures enterprise, service provider, and government organizations worldwide through its Fortinet Security Fabric cybersecurity platform. The company is seeking a Junior AI Automation Engineer to build and maintain a technical interview pipeline covering question management, AI-assisted scoring, quality validation, fairness monitoring, and end-to-end workflow automation.
What you'll do:
- We're looking for a junior engineer to be the primary engineer building and maintaining our technical interview pipeline - from the question bank to AI-assisted scoring to full workflow automation - working alongside the team to grow this role into a broader automation function over time. This isn't a "call an API and ship it" job: you'll be designing the systems that add/calibrate interview questions and evaluate candidate answers, which means understanding how to prompt and structure AI models for consistency, how to measure and validate output quality against ground truth, and how to catch and correct the ways these systems get things wrong. This is a role we expect to grow - the shape of that growth is still being defined
- Add, revise, and retire technical interview questions across roles/levels/skill areas
- Maintain question metadata (difficulty, topic tags, expected answer criteria, role relevance)
- Create variant/randomized versions of questions to reduce answer-sharing risk
- Build validation checks (automated and manual) to catch incorrect, ambiguous, or miscalibrated questions before they enter the repository
- Build automation to update problem sets and recalculate average difficulty ratings as new results come in
- Review and update questions periodically to prevent leakage/staleness and keep content aligned with actual job requirements
- Architect scoring workflows that evaluate and compare candidate answers against reference answers/rubrics, grounded in a clear methodology for what "correct" and "well-scored" mean
- Calibrate and benchmark scoring prompts/models against human-graded samples, measuring accuracy and identifying systematic errors or bias
- Understand and account for model failure modes (inconsistency, hallucination, prompt sensitivity) and design safeguards around them
- Flag edge cases or low-confidence scores for human review rather than fully automating high-stakes decisions
- Automate the end-to-end workflow: question selection -> test delivery -> answer collection -> scoring -> reporting
What they're looking for:
- - Bachelor's degree in Computer Science or related field, or equivalent practical experience
- - Solid programming fundamentals (Python, JavaScript/TypeScript, or similar)
- - Comfort working with APIs, including LLM/AI APIs (OpenAI, Anthropic, etc.)
- - Demonstrated experience designing and evaluating prompts/pipelines for LLM-based tools (not just using AI products, but building with them)
- - Proficient with Git and a hosted platform (GitHub or GitLab) - branching, PRs/MRs, code review, CI basics
- - Basic understanding of databases (SQL or similar)
- - Strong attention to detail and technical writing ability
- - Ability to work independently on processes that are still being defined, and adapt as scope evolves
- Must be authorized to work in the U.S. without sponsorship
- - Familiarity with test/assessment platforms or ATS integrations
- - Exposure to scripting automation (e.g., workflow tools, cron jobs, CI-style pipelines)
- - Interest or coursework in fairness/bias in ML systems
